Job Summary:
Reporting to the Home Support Supervisor, the Community PSW is expected to deliver high-quality of care and service that will support patients to live comfortably and safely in their home environment. The services provided will be outlined in the written plan of care prepared by the primary health care professional. S.R.T. MedStaff is currently recruiting for Personal Support Workers (PSWs) in Toronto and surrounding areas to work in the community setting. 

Compensation:
$28.50 - $30.50 hourly 

Responsibilities:
  • Assist patients with activities of daily living, including meal preparation, shopping, light housekeeping, laundry, and respite care.
  • Assess the environment for safety during each patient visit.
  • Treat patients with compassion and respect.
  • Use judgment in carrying out instructions and recognize the need to seek supervisory assistance.
  • Report/communicate observations or concerns to the appropriate individual(s), as necessary.
  • Keep all patient information confidential.
  • Work as a team with other healthcare professionals and service providers.
 

Qualifications: 
  • Must be at least 18 years of age.
  • Proficient verbal and written English communication skills.
  • Ability to speak a second language is considered an asset.
  • Ability to travel between assignments either by transit or car.
  • Successful completion of a Ministry of Education-approved PSW Training Program or equivalent credential is required. 
  • HSCPOA registration is considered an asset.
  • Experience working as a Community PSW is considered an asset.
  • Negative T.B. skin test or chest x-ray.
  • Current CPR (BCLS) and First Aid Certificate.
  • Meet health surveillance requirements of the Public Hospitals Act.
  • VSS within the past year of hire confirming absence of a criminal history/record.
